Elon Musk: Elon Musk cannot keep Tesla pay package worth more than $55 billion, judge rules

The ruling by Chancellor Kathaleen St. Jude McCormick comes more than five years after a shareholder lawsuit targeted Tesla CEO Musk and directors of the company. They were accused of breaching their duties to the maker of electric vehicles and solar panels, resulting in a waste of corporate assets and unjust enrichment for Musk.

Judge orders Tesla to undo pay package that helped make Musk world's richest person

The approval process for the compensation package was 'deeply flawed,' Chancellor Kathaleen McCormick wrote, in part because of the CEO's close ties with the people representing the company.
